// Conflict resolution for Syncwell calendar plugins.
//
// When a local edit and a remote edit collide, the resolver picks a
// winner by timestamp, then source priority. Plugin authors must not
// assume local-wins. Conflicts older than the stale window are dropped
// silently. The resolver is tuned by the constants below.

tuning table, kajog-bawip:
TIERS = {
    "kelius": 256,
    "lammir": 543,
}

## Build provenance — catalogue import

The Wrenshelf catalogue importer is built hermetically; no network fetches at compile time. All MARC-parsing deps are pinned and vendored under third_party/. Reviewers: check the lockfile hash matches the manifest before approving. Provenance attestation is generated per build and archived for ninety days. The current attested artifact corresponds to the build stamped below:

session token of yajof-bagef = htk4_937d

Visiting contractors may use the quiet room on the top floor of Thorncliff House for calls and focused work only. No meetings, no food, phones on silent. The room is unbookable; first come, first served. Leave it as found. Contractors must sign in at reception before heading up. The door is keypad-locked; enter with the code below.

door code, yahif-yagag: bdg-FKXEAK-64235764